before_script:
- apt update -qq
- - DEBIAN_FRONTEND=noninteractive apt install --no-install-recommends -y >
- -qq -o=Dpkg::Use-Pty=0 libc-dev gcc make autoconf automake libncurses-dev >
- gnutls-dev git
+ - DEBIAN_FRONTEND=noninteractive apt install --no-install-recommends -y -qq -o=Dpkg::Use-Pty=0 libc-dev gcc make autoconf automake libncurses-dev gnutls-dev git
stages:
- test-all
test-all:
stage: test-all
script:
- - DEBIAN_FRONTEND=noninteractive apt install --no-install-recommends -y >
- -qq -o=Dpkg::Use-Pty=0 inotify-tools
+ - DEBIAN_FRONTEND=noninteractive apt install --no-install-recommends -y -qq -o=Dpkg::Use-Pty=0 inotify-tools
- ./autogen.sh autoconf
- ./configure --without-makeinfo
- make bootstrap
- make check-expensive
after_script:
- - DEBIAN_FRONTEND=noninteractive apt remove --no-install-recommends -y >
- -qq -o=Dpkg::Use-Pty=0 inotify-tools
+ - DEBIAN_FRONTEND=noninteractive apt remove --no-install-recommends -y -qq -o=Dpkg::Use-Pty=0 inotify-tools
test-filenotify-gio:
stage: test-filenotify-gio
- lisp/filenotify.el
- test/lisp/filenotify-tests.el
script:
- - DEBIAN_FRONTEND=noninteractive apt install --no-install-recommends -y >
- -qq -o=Dpkg::Use-Pty=0 libglib2.0-bin
+ - DEBIAN_FRONTEND=noninteractive apt install --no-install-recommends -y -qq -o=Dpkg::Use-Pty=0 libglib2.0-bin
- ./autogen.sh autoconf
- ./configure --without-makeinfo --with-file-notification=gfile
- make bootstrap
- make -C test filenotify-tests
after_script:
- - DEBIAN_FRONTEND=noninteractive apt remove --no-install-recommends -y >
- -qq -o=Dpkg::Use-Pty=0 libglib2.0-bin
+ - DEBIAN_FRONTEND=noninteractive apt remove --no-install-recommends -y -qq -o=Dpkg::Use-Pty=0 libglib2.0-bin